I took the plunge and purchased a Coolscan V. I received it this morning and I'm like a kid with a new toy. There is something weird though.
1. First the USB plug at the rear of the unit moves quite a lot - well for a USB plug... nothing like I have seen before - it's almost like it has unsoldered or broken from the main board. Is it the same for you?
2. When I power up the scanner it goes through all its blinking LED stages and finally I get a LED that's on, but if I tilt the scanner just a tiny bit it goes through the whole init stage again. At first I though it was the USB connection that was lost because of the flimsy plug but no, it looks more like the scanner can detect the slightest change in position, and if that happens it resets itself like a mindless zombie. Does your Coolscan do the same? Kinda annoying because I work on an antique desk and it's not really flat so if the scanner reinits everytime I sneeze that's not practical.
